package thorlog

import (
"time"
)

// EBPFProgram describes an eBPF program attached to a specific endpoint in the kernel.
//
// To use eBPF nomenclature: This struct describes an eBPF link and its corresponding program.
//
// eBPF programs can be attached to a wide range of things; the LinkType contains what sort of object
// the program is attached to, and AttachTarget contains what specific object it is attached to.
//
// EBPFProgram has a content that contains the (kernel translated) instructions,
// provided that the kernel does not hide them due to the kernel.kptr_restrict sysctl.
type EBPFProgram struct {
LogObjectHeader

// Tag is a hash calculated by the kernel over the program instructions.
// It can be used to uniquely identify the attached program.
Tag string `textlog:"tag" json:"tag"`
// User that loaded the eBPF program
User string `textlog:"user" json:"user"`
// Program name
Name string `textlog:"name" json:"name"`
// Size of the loaded program.
//
// This relates to instructions that have already been rewritten by the kernel;
// as such, it does not have to be the exact size of the instructions that were passed
// when the program was loaded.
Size uint64 `textlog:"size" json:"size"`
// Maps used by this program
Maps []string `json:"maps"`
// Functions declared by this program
Functions []string `json:"functions"`
// Timestamp when this program was loaded
LoadTime time.Time `textlog:"load_time" json:"load_time"`
// RAM locked by this eBPF program
MemoryLocked uint64 `json:"memory_locked"`
// Type of object the eBPF program is attached to (kprobe, syscall, tracepoint, ...)
LinkType string `textlog:"link_type" json:"link_type"`
// eBPF program type, i.e. whether this is a program for packet inspection / kprobe / tracepoint / ...
ProgramType string `json:"program_type"`
// The object the eBPF program is attached to.
//
// Depending on the LinkType, different fields will be present in this struct.
AttachTarget EBPFAttachTarget `textlog:",expand" json:"attach_target"`
// Content contains extracts from the kernel translated instructions that are
// relevant for matches on this program.
Content *SparseData `json:"content,omitempty"`
}

// EBPFAttachTarget describes the target that a BPF program is attached to.
type EBPFAttachTarget struct {
// uprobe / tracepoint / cgroup specific; the path of the hooked ELF / tracepoint / cgroup, respectively
Path string `textlog:"path,omitempty" json:"path,omitempty"`
// uprobe specific; the PID of the hooked process, or nothing if the probe is for all processes
Pid uint32 `textlog:"pid,omitempty" json:"pid,omitempty"`
// uprobe / kprobe specific; the symbols that are hooked
Symbols StringList `textlog:"symbol,omitempty" json:"symbols,omitempty"`
// netkit / TCX / XDP specific; Network interface that the eBPF is attached to
Interface string `textlog:"interface,omitempty" json:"interface,omitempty"`
// netns / tracing / perf event specific; ID of the object attached to
ObjectId int64 `textlog:"object_id,omitempty" json:"object_id,omitempty"`
// netfilter specific; Protocol family (IPv4 or IPv6)
Protocol string `textlog:"protocol,omitempty" json:"protocol,omitempty"`
// netfilter specific; Hook (prerouting, postrouting, forward, local in, or local out)
Hook string `textlog:"hook,omitempty" json:"hook,omitempty"`
// netfilter specific; Priority (lower is executed earlier)
Priority int `textlog:"priority,omitempty" json:"priority,omitempty"`
}

func (EBPFProgram) reportable() {}

const typeEbpfProgram = "eBPF program"

func init() { AddLogObjectType(typeEbpfProgram, &EBPFProgram{}) }

func NewEBPFProgram() *EBPFProgram {
return &EBPFProgram{
LogObjectHeader: LogObjectHeader{
Type: typeEbpfProgram,
},
}
}
